DS Keyer Screen
KONA LHe Installation and Operation Manual — Using The KONA LHe
The KONA LHe has a hardware-based downstream keyer that is ideal for putting logos, “bugs” or other video material with an alpha channel on top of video being played out or printed to tape.
A typical application would be putting a television station's call letters or channel over program video content. Keyed video can be from the KONA's internal Frame Buffer (from storage, video
In, KONA TV, etc.) or from a graphics file that has an alpha channel (PhotoShop etc.).

KONA LHe Control Panel, DS Keyer Tab
DS Keyer Screen Settings
Downstream Keyer Mode:
Downstream Keyer Off — when this pulldown menu item is selected the downstream keyer will be turned off
Frame Buffer over Matte— places the keyed video with alpha channel currently in the
Frame Buffer over a fixed color matte determined by the “Matte Color” setting set separately.
Frame Buffer over Video In—places the keyed video currently in the Frame Buffer over the video input for playout or print-to-tape.
Matte Color: only available when the pulldown “Frame Buffer over Matte” or “Graphic over Matte” are selected-pressing this button brings up a color selection dialog. The dialog provides a variety of ways to select a matte color including a color wheel, color picker (choose from a location anywhere on the computer screen), numeric sliders, swatches, “crayons”, and spectrums. The matte chosen will be used as a video background under the keyed video.
Foreground pre-multiplied (checkbox): use to avoid “matte lines” and improve the appearance of the foreground (key) being composited over the background.
Audio Out:
Frame Buffer—select audio out to be routed from the contents of the Frame Buffer.
Audio In—select audio out to be routed from KONA’s currently selected input(s).
